However, I'm stumped on this one, which may or may not be related to
the DSL.  When trying to have a resource have a simple dependency on
two things at once, it simply fails, and I'm stumped as to why.  The
error message is:

Parameter require failed: No title provided and "[ Exec[git-/usr/local/
resque-runner], Rvm_install[1.9.2-p136]]" is not a valid resource
reference

My definition looks like this:

define :bundle_install, :rvm do
  rvm_exec "bundle...@name}",
           :command => "bundle install --without production",
           :ruby => @rvm,
           :path => "/bin:/usr/bin:/sbin:/usr/sbin:/usr/local/bin",

           # this alone works:
           #:require => "rvm_install...@rvm}]",

           # this alone also works:
           #:require => "exec[git...@name}]",

          # this fails:
          :require => "[ exec[git...@name}], rvm_install...@rvm}]]",

           :cwd => @name,
           :creates => "#...@name}/.bundle/config"
end

Am I missing something, or should I open a ticket?
